Nobby Loves Grey Nomads!  So much so they offer a free camp for motorhomes and caravans at the Old disused Railway Station.

It is a large flat piece of land opposite the famous Rudds’s Pub.  It has some shade and is located in the heart of town so you can get to all the places to see on foot.  At one end there are four power poles so you can hook up to power for a donation, or if you don’t need power you can stretch out down the southern end as there is plenty of room.

 

Nobby has been home to two prominent Australians, Steele Rudd, the creator of the Dad & Dave stories and Sister Kenny who played a big role in the way Polio was treated in the early 1900’s.  Both are recognised in town at Rudds Pub & The Sister Kenny Memorial.

There is also a great little General Store which makes an outstanding coffee.

HOW TO GET THERE
It is situated in Nobby, 35kms from Toowoomba and only 2 hours from Brisbane. Coming from Toowoomba, take the New England Hwy/Ruthven St, continue on New England Hwy to Nobby Connection Rd, turn left at the end then make a U-turn over the railway and the Pub is on the left.

FEES & BOOKINGS
There is no charge to camp at this location if you don’t require power, but they would appreciate your support around the town.  If you do wish to use the power, they ask for a donation to be placed in the donation box at the side entrance to the Craft Shop.

THINGS TO DO
Check out Rudd’s Pub, opposite the campsite and find out all about Dad & Dave.

Visit the Old Railway Craft Shop full of local arts and craft and memorabilia.

Visit the Sister Kenny Memorial

Visit “The Darling Downs Zoo” home of the famous white tigers.
